Julian Lage-Inspired OM Tone with Adirondack Clarity
$8,365.00
The Collings OMI A JL SB is a compact, vintage-inspired acoustic that delivers an impressive amount of tone and character for its size. Its Adirondack spruce top and Honduran mahogany body create a dry, woody voice with excellent clarity, quick response, and surprising projection. The smaller body size makes it exceptionally comfortable to play, while the Adirondack top provides plenty of headroom and dynamic range when pushed. Finished in a beautiful 1-Style Sunburst with classic tortoise appointments and Waverly tuners, it captures the feel of a well-loved pre-war instrument. Responsive, articulate, and full of vintage charm, this OMI offers a remarkably rich voice in an intimate package.
Two of Julian Lage’s primary goals for the OM1 JL model was pure and “honest” tone accompanied by simple, understated appointments. Thus, in the interest of staying true to the concept, we’ve limited customization of this model to a few select options. Among these is an upgrade to an Adirondack spruce top, which offers the highest stiffness to weight ratio of any of the spruces and in effect maximizes tonal potential. We also offer our 1-style sunburst, which blends beautifully with the tortoise bindings and semi-gloss finish, maintaining the minimal and elegant aesthetic of the instrument.

Bill Collings has been inspiring generations of guitarists with his fine guitars and mandolins since the 1970s. After dropping out of medical school to pursue his interest in guitar building, he moved to Austin, Texas where he and his company, Collings Guitars, operate to this day. From his humble beginnings as a one-man operation in a two-bedroom apartment to his current 22,000 square-foot facility and approximately 70 employees, Collings has built a reputation for producing high quality instruments with care and precision.
Perhaps best known for flat-top acoustic guitars, Collings excels in a variety of classic-inspired designs and modern build concepts. Their D series guitars represent their take on the iconic 14-fret square-shouldered dreadnought and include the highly-favored D1 and D2H models with mahogany and rosewood back and sides respectively. These guitars are extremely well-balanced and have a strong reputation for reliability and consistently becoming stronger as the woods open up over time. The CW models in this series feature Adirondack tops, larger sound holes, and other specs especially coveted by bluegrass flat pickers for their volume and responsiveness. The Collings OM series guitars tend to be lively, balanced, and lyrical. These guitars are hugely popular amongst fingerstyle players for their dynamic sensitivity, size, and playability. One of the most versatile acoustic guitar designs, Collings OMs can also handle heavy strumming and flat picking easily when the player needs to dig in. The CJ is a fantastic slope-shouldered dreadnought, and the SJ is their incredible small jumbo design. Collings also makes astounding parlor-style 0, 00, 000, and Baby guitars, which are perfect for performance or travel and offered with the same variety of options as the larger lines for true customization of tone and appearance. Rounding out Collings’ acoustic lines is the C10, which is modeled after a parlor guitar but with a design concept that makes it a favorite of electric players.
Collings is ahead of the pack in the acoustic guitar game, but it certainly does not end there. Their electric guitars are highly regarded amongst players across the entire spectrum of musical traditions. Designed and built with the same knowledge and attention to detail as the flat-tops, Collings electrics are quickly gaining recognition as contending with the best of the best of electric guitars. Hard rockers and country pickers and everyone in between can find a Collings electric to fit their style, from the Les Paul-inspired shapes of the 290, 360, and CL series to the semi-hollow I-35s and SoCo Deluxe models. Collings also offers A and T-style mandolins, as well as concert and tenor ukuleles.

Top: Adirondack Spruce Top
Back & Sides: Honduran Mahogany
Neck: Honduran Mahogany
Finish: 1-Style Sunburst
Fingerboard: Ebony
Bridge: Ebony
Tuners: Nickel Waverly
Number of Frets: 20
Body Binding: Tortoise
Inlay: MOP Dots
Truss Rode: Fully Adjustable
Pickguard; Tortoise
Case: Deluxe Hardshell
Weight: 3lbs 14oz
